The Apparel Export Landscape in 2024
As we look toward 2024, the apparel export industry is poised for significant changes. Trends in consumer behavior, sustainability, and technology are influencing how suppliers approach the global market. Staying informed about these trends is essential for B2B suppliers seeking to thrive in the coming year.
Rise of Conscious Consumerism
Conscious consumerism continues to gain traction as consumers prioritize ethical and sustainable practices in their purchasing decisions. Apparel exporters must adapt by highlighting their commitment to responsible sourcing and production methods. Transparency in the supply chain will be a critical factor for brands looking to appeal to these consumers.
Technological Advancements in Production
Technological advancements are reshaping production processes in the apparel export sector. Automation and AI are streamlining operations, reducing costs, and improving efficiency. Exporters who invest in these technologies can enhance their competitiveness and meet the growing demand for faster turnaround times.
Customization and Personalization Trends
Consumers are increasingly seeking customized and personalized products that reflect their individual styles. Apparel exporters can leverage this trend by offering made-to-order items or customizable options. Adapting to these preferences can set suppliers apart in a crowded market.
Social Media Influence on Fashion
Social media continues to play a significant role in shaping fashion trends and consumer choices. Apparel exporters should embrace social media marketing strategies to connect with potential buyers and showcase their products. Platforms like Instagram and TikTok are powerful tools for reaching younger audiences and building brand loyalty.
Global Supply Chain Resilience
In light of recent global challenges, building resilience in supply chains is more important than ever. Apparel exporters should diversify their sourcing strategies and invest in risk management practices. This approach will help mitigate disruptions and ensure a more stable flow of products to international markets.
